Additional tree cover (change)

Overview

This layer shows the additional tree canopy created under a modeled scenario implementation. Trees are added within plantable areas until the target canopy coverage is reached. The height and crown structure of the simulated trees are derived from the characteristics of existing trees in the city to represent realistic planting outcomes.

Function
To estimate the tree canopy cover that would result from implementing the scenario.

Cautions
Modeled tree scenarios are hypothetical and only represent one possible outcome. Addtionally, the data is only as strong as its supporting layers. Our input datasets might not be completely accurate in terms of the location and height of urban features like buildings and trees. The scenarios are suitable for guiding assessments of heat and the potential for creating interventions, but are not intended to serve as a tool for designing tree planting programs.
